Why learning English as a youth is important

English is considered the universal language spoken all over the world. It is considered a highly valuable skill that can help communicate and connect with people of different nationalities, cultures and backgrounds. In today's competitive world, acquiring English as a second language has become more necessary than ever before for the youth.

Start with basic vocabulary

The first step in learning English is to start with the basics. It is essential to build your vocabulary as it can help in understanding and communicating properly. Begin with simple words and phrases in daily life situations, like greetings, introducing oneself, ordering food, etc., to build confidence in speaking.

Practice listening skills regularly

To develop better English skills, it's important to have good listening skills. Regularly listening to English news, podcasts, songs, and watching movies or TV shows with subtitles can help in gaining a better understanding of the language. This can improve pronunciation, vocabulary, and grammar skills.

Speak and write English regularly

One of the best ways to improve English proficiency is by speaking and writing in English regularly. Practice speaking in English with friends or tutors, and don't be afraid to make mistakes. Writing in English, like keeping a journal or writing essays, can also help in improving grammar, vocabulary, and sentence structure.

Take courses and seek help from professionals

There are many English learning courses available for the youth to take, such as online courses, local language schools or private tutoring. These can provide structured and tailored lessons to meet your learning needs. Also, seeking help from English-speaking friends or professionals can help in correcting mistakes and providing guidance.

Conclusion

Acquiring English language skills as a youth is essential to have a successful future both personally and professionally. It takes consistent effort and practice to improve your English, so don't be discouraged from making mistakes. Remember, the more you practice, the more confident and proficient you will become.
